How much do international strategy remote j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 26, 2026, the average yearly pay for international strategy remote in the United States is $124,659.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$90,000.00 and $157,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Position Summary:

As a Senior Tax Manager, you will lead U.S. Federal and International tax compliance and reporting, drive strategic tax planning, and serve as a key advisor to executive leadership. You will manage a high-performing team, foster cross-functional collaboration, and champion process improvements and automation in tax operations. This role offers professional development, and the opportunity to shape the company's global tax strategy.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ead and mentor a diverse team of tax professionals, fostering growth and development
  • Oversee all aspects of U.S. federal and international tax compliance, including consolidated returns and related disclosures (Forms 1120, 1118, 5471, 8858, 8865, 8990, 8991, 8992, and foreign tax credit filings)
  • Manage the U.S. federal and international components of the quarterly and annual income tax provision under ASC 740, including calculations related to Subpart F, GILTI, FDII, BEAT, and FTCs
  • Support strategic tax planning for M&A, intercompany transactions, repatriation strategies, and business initiatives
  • Implement automation and leverage technology for process improvement, including tax compliance and provision software (e.g., OneSource, ITC, Alteryx, Excel) and ERP systems
  • Advise senior management on tax implications for business decisions and evolving U.S. and international tax laws
  • Maintain and review taxable income calculations, E&P calculations, and tax basis for both domestic and foreign entities
  • Coordinate with external advisors on complex technical areas and compliance co-sourcing
  • Support IRS and foreign tax audits, responding to inquiries and managing data requests
  • Champion continuous improvement in tax processes, systems, and controls to increase accuracy and efficiency
  • Promote a culture of innovation, collaboration, and inclusion within the tax team and across the organization

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in Accounting, Finance, or related field; CPA or MST preferred
  • 7-9+ years of progressive experience in U.S. federal and international tax, including significant experience with income tax compliance and ASC 740 reporting, gained at a Big-4 accounting firm and/or in an in-house role
  • Strong technical knowledge of U.S. tax code, including Subpart F, GILTI, FDII, BEAT, and FTC regimes
  • Proven leadership skills with experience developing and managing a tax tea
  • Excellent organizational, analytical, and communication skills
  • Experience with tax compliance and provision software and ERP systems (e.g., OneSource, ITC, Alteryx, Excel, SAP, Oracle)
  • Self-starter with the ability to work independently, manage multiple priorities and deadlines in a dynamic, fast-paced environment
  • Demonstrated ability to lead cross-functional teams, mentor junior staff, and communicate complex tax concepts to non-experts
